Plant Description: Senna italica is a small and floriferous little shrub that does well in full sun. Sometimes it will have trailing stems. The bright yellow flowers gradually turn brown with age and is followed by attractive flat pods. The flat seeds have been used as a coffee substitute. Senna italica is ideal for the smaller garden and a good addition to a grassland garden as well ...
About Senna italica Plant : Habit : A diffuse perennial herb with stems glabrous, woody below, branches spreading. Leaves : Rachis glabrous, without any glands. Leaflets 3-6 pairs, glabrous above, more or less glabrous beneath, stipules minute very acute. Inflorescence : Axillary racemes. Flowers : Yellow, stamens 7, very unequal. Fruit : Pods very typical, flat, thin, glabrous ...
Senna italica, Senegal senna, Italian senna, or Port Royal senna is a legume tree in the genus Senna. It is recognized by many other common names based on the regions it grows in. In India, it is used to produce a dye known as “neutral henna”. Senegal senna is easily distinguishable through its many distinctive features.
Medicinal Uses and Pharmacology/ Scientific studies: Leaves, pods and seeds of Senna italica are mostly used in traditional medicine. They are taken, usually as a decoction or maceration, to cure stomach complaints, fever, jaundice, venereal diseases and biliousness.

Senna italica, a member of the Fabaceae family (subfamily Caesalpiniaceae), is widely used in South African traditional medicine to treat a number of disease conditions. Aqueous extracts of the plant are mainly used to treat sexually transmitted infections and intestinal complications. The roots of S. italica were ground to a fine powder and sequentially extracted with n-hexane ...

The roots of Senna italica were collected from Zebediela subregion, Limpopo province (S.A), powdered and extracted with acetone by cold/shaking extraction method. The phytochemical composition of the extract was determined by thin layer chromatography (TLC). The chromatograms were visualised with vanillin-sulphuric acid and p-anisaldehyde reagents. The total phenolic content of the extract was ...

2019-12-14 Cassia obovata (Senna italica) is a plant that contains a faint golden or slight yellow dye; known also as "neutral henna" or "senna obovata", it has the conditioning benefits of henna. Cassia obovata is safe to use on over relaxed, bleached and dyed hair and can last anytime from a few shampoos to permanently. It will give dark hair a ...
